NAT is known as the
technology that is helping IPv4 hold on for dear life. It works by translating
private IP addresses to internet routable addresses since private IP addresses
are not routable on the internet. IPv4 has three classes of private IP addresses
and you can find more detail about them in RFC 1918. These private IPv4
addresses are typically used for internal devices like your Servers, PCs,
Laptops, Tablets, Cell Phone, Printers, etc.. For these devices to access the
internet they will have to be translated to routable addresses for processing
on the internet.